Overview

Wireless Festival drops a huge contemporary lineup into Finsbury Park and gives it a very London shape: midday arrivals by Tube and rail, long afternoons that build toward the biggest sets, and a late-night push back through North London stations after the headliners finish. It feels less like an isolated camping weekend and more like three big city festival days stitched into a London trip, with rap, R&B, crossover pop, and a crowd that comes ready for the evening peak.

What to Expect

Morning is more about getting across London and lining up than action inside the park, since gates open around midday and the site fills gradually after that. Early afternoon feels looser, with shorter waits for food and more room to get your bearings. By mid to late afternoon, queues thicken at bars and traders as the bill steps up. Evening is the real surge, when Main stage headline sets pull the biggest crowd and the park takes on that packed, all-eyes-forward feel. After dark, the energy stays high until the final run of performances ends, then the night shifts quickly into a slow walk out toward the station approaches and managed exits.

Tips for First Timers

Get to Finsbury Park earlier than your favorite set rather than aiming for the late-afternoon rush, because security lines can slow down before major performances. Keep your phone charged and zipped away when you are in food lines, bars, and the tighter parts of the crowd. Pick a clear meeting point inside the park before the evening sets start. On the way out, do not expect a quick dash onto the first train at Finsbury Park Station; wear shoes you can stand in for hours and be ready for a patient walk after close.

Budget

Staying near Finsbury Park or along direct Tube and rail links cuts late-night hassle but pushes hotel prices up across the 10-12 July weekend. A cheaper plan is to sleep farther out on a straightforward Underground route and ride in before the afternoon build. Inside the park, food and drinks add up fast over a full day, especially if you are buying rounds between sets. The expensive version of Wireless is central London accommodation plus premium tickets; the leaner version is standard admission, an outer-zone hotel, and one solid meal before you enter.

Safety

The tightest spots are the entry gates, the main stage during headline sets, and the walk back toward Finsbury Park Station after close. Give yourself extra time for security, keep valuables out of back pockets in bar and food queues, and do not force your way deeper into a packed crowd if you are already uncomfortable with the space. If you are meeting friends after the final act, choose a point away from the busiest station approaches and expect a slow exit.

Food & Drink

Wireless leans into fast, filling festival food that suits a long standing day in Finsbury Park: easy handheld meals between sets, salty queue food in the late afternoon, and drinks that are quick to grab before heading back toward the stage. Expect the strongest demand around the build into evening, when people are trying to eat before the headline run starts. Must Try:
